What Causes This Problem
- Age and corrosion of pipes can lead to slab leaks.
- Ground movement may create cracks and leaks in plumbing.
- Improper installation of plumbing systems can cause issues.
- High water pressure can strain pipes and lead to breaks.
- Tree roots may infiltrate sewer lines, resulting in damages.

How Can I Identify A Slab Leak?
Common signs of a slab leak include areas of dampness on floors, the smell of mold, and unusually high water bills. Quick detection is key to preventing significant damage.

What Preventive Measures Can I Take?
Regular inspections and maintenance of plumbing systems can help prevent slab leaks. It’s also advisable to monitor your water bills and be alert to any changes in your water pressure.
